Summary

Fix output pipeline data loss and exec server failures after snapshot restore, plus several test reliability improvements.

Output Pipeline Fixes (commits 854ff7a, 195e6ae, 042b363, 6026ba1)

After snapshot restore (both pre-start and clone), the vsock transport is reset (VIRTIO_VSOCK_EVENT_TRANSPORT_RESET), breaking all connections. The output pipeline had three bugs causing silent data loss:

  1. Stale connection race (854ff7a): The output listener read from connection Replace custom PassthroughFs with fuse-backend-rs #1 while fc-agent wrote to connection #N. Fixed with a select! loop that races read_line against listener.accept(), always switching to the newest connection.

  2. Double reconnect (195e6ae): Both handle_clone_restore() and notify_cache_ready_and_wait() triggered output.reconnect() for the same restore event. The second reconnect killed the connection the first just established. Fixed by removing the duplicate — only the restore-epoch watcher reconnects output.

  3. Notify stored-permit cascade (042b363): tokio::sync::Notify::notify_one() stores a permit if no one is waiting. After restore, multiple permits accumulated, causing the output writer to cycle through ghost connections in rapid succession, each consuming a stored permit. Fixed by draining stored permits.

  4. Dead vsock detection via write probe (6026ba1): notify_cache_ready_and_wait() polled for POLLHUP to detect snapshot restore, but POLLHUP wasn't reliably delivered in rootless mode. The agent waited the full 30s timeout before continuing. Fixed by actively writing to the connection — dead sockets fail instantly with EPIPE/ECONNRESET.

Exec Server Fix (commits 464c471, 6cb312e)

After vsock transport reset, the exec server's VsockListener wrapped in AsyncFd has stale epoll registration. accept() hangs forever because tokio never delivers readability events.

  • Initial fix (464c471): Drop old listener and rebind. This failed when active connections kept the port bound (EADDRINUSE infinite retry loop).
  • Correct fix (6cb312e): Use VsockListener::re_register() to extract the socket fd from AsyncFd (deregistering from epoll) and re-wrap it (re-registering), without closing or rebinding the socket. Falls back to full rebind with 50-retry limit.

Three bugs caused container stdout to not reach the host after snapshot restore:

1. put_mmds before VM resume: Firecracker accepts PUT /mmds while the VM is
   paused but the guest-visible data isn't updated. fc-agent never sees the
   new restore-epoch so it never reconnects. Fix: move put_mmds after resume.

2. Unconditional notify_one: cmd_snapshot_run fired output_reconnect.notify_one()
   for all snapshot types. For pre-start snapshots (container not yet running),
   the listener has no dead connection to drop. The stored Notify permit poisons
   the first real connection by immediately triggering the reconnect branch in
   select!, dropping a valid connection. Fix: only notify for startup snapshots.

3. Listener stuck on stale connection: fc-agent reconnects multiple times during
   snapshot create/restore cycles. Each reconnect creates a new vsock connection
   queued in the listener's accept backlog. The listener accepted the FIRST
   connection and blocked on read_line, while fc-agent wrote to the LATEST
   connection. Fix: race read_line against listener.accept() in tokio::select!,
   always switching to the newest connection.

Also adds output verification to test_heavy_output_after_snapshot_restore to
catch this class of bug — the test previously only checked health and exec,
not that container output actually reached the host.

After pre-start snapshot restore, output.reconnect() was called twice:
1. By handle_clone_restore() via the restore-epoch watcher
2. By the explicit call at agent.rs:230 after notify_cache_ready_and_wait

The double reconnect combined with tokio::sync::Notify's stored-permit
behavior caused the output writer to cycle through ghost connections.
Each reconnect created a new vsock connection that was immediately
abandoned when the next reconnect fired, before any data was written.

The host listener saw empty connections (0 lines, immediate EOF),
causing container output like "not a tty" to be dropped entirely.

Fix: remove the explicit reconnect at agent.rs:230. The epoch watcher
already handles output reconnection via handle_clone_restore().

The output writer used tokio::sync::Notify to interrupt blocking waits
during reconnection. When the select! handler consumed a notification,
it re-stored the permit via notify_one() (intended for the disconnected
branch). This created a self-poisoning cycle: the next select! would
fire immediately on the ghost permit, dropping the freshly-reconnected
stream before any data was written.

Fix:
- Remove Notify re-store in select! handlers (the flag drives reconnect)
- Extract reconnect logic into try_reconnect() helper
- Use the AtomicBool flag as the single source of truth
- Disconnected branch uses timeout fallback (200ms) for robustness

Add 3 tests:
- test_double_reconnect_does_not_drop_messages: verifies flag+notify
  collapse multiple reconnect() calls into one cycle
- test_no_notify_permit_cascade: verifies no ghost permits after
  consuming a notification (the old code re-stored them)
- test_messages_survive_reconnect_window: verifies messages queued
  during reconnection are preserved in the channel

After snapshot restore, the vsock transport is reset but POLLHUP is not
reliably delivered on the restored fd (observed in rootless mode). This
causes notify_cache_ready_and_wait() to fall through to its 30s timeout,
delaying container startup by ~45s.

Add an active write probe in the poll timeout branch: writing to a dead
connection fails immediately with EPIPE/ECONNRESET/ENOTCONN, providing
reliable detection that a snapshot was taken. With this fix, the dead
connection is detected in <1s instead of waiting 30s.

Also adds a timing assertion to the integration test (warm_start_secs < 30)
to catch future regressions in snapshot restore detection.

Tested: test_heavy_output_after_snapshot_restore passes — warm start
healthy in ~2s (was 45s+ without write probe).

After snapshot restore, VIRTIO_VSOCK_EVENT_TRANSPORT_RESET invalidates
the exec server's VsockListener. The AsyncFd epoll registration becomes
stale — accept() hangs forever because tokio never delivers readability
events for incoming connections.

Add a Notify-based rebind signal shared between the exec server, the
restore-epoch watcher, and the cache-ready handshake. When either
detects a snapshot restore, it signals the exec server to drop the old
listener and bind a fresh socket with new epoll registration.

Changes:
- exec.rs: accept rebind_signal, select! between accept and rebind
- agent.rs: create exec_rebind Notify, wire to exec server + watcher
- restore.rs: signal exec rebind in handle_clone_restore()
- mmds.rs: pass exec_rebind through watch_restore_epoch()

The committed rebind approach (drop listener, bind new socket) fails
when spawned handle_connection tasks hold active connections on the
port. bind() returns EADDRINUSE and the exec server gets stuck in an
infinite retry loop, unable to accept new connections.

Fix: extract the socket fd from AsyncFd (deregistering from epoll)
and re-wrap it in a new AsyncFd (re-registering with epoll), without
closing the socket. This refreshes the stale epoll registration after
vsock transport reset while preserving active connections.

Falls back to full drop+rebind with 50-retry limit if re-register
fails, preventing infinite loops.

Add VsockListener::re_register() method to vsock.rs.
